## Timeline: 09:14 — Replica lag alarm (Dovecote cluster)

09:14: Lag on read replica crossed 45s; alarm fired. 09:17: On-call confirmed bulk backfill job saturating WAL shipping. 09:21: Job throttled; lag recovering. No reads served stale auth data per audit sampling. Relevant pipeline run is identified by the trace token below.

trace token, kahog-tajeg: htk6_97d963

**Vendor note: Inkmill markdown pipeline**

Rendering for Parchway docs is outsourced to Inkmill under an annual contract, renewing each March. They handle sanitization and PDF export; we own the upload queue. SLA: 4-hour response on rendering failures. Escalate only after two failed retries. Their support desk is reachable at the address below.

billing contact of hahaf-baguf = zorael.tammir.jorius@sivrelhq.internal

Checklist item: GC pauses — Matchwell service. Before sign-off, run the pairing load test for 30 min and confirm p99 pause stays under 40ms. If pauses spike, check heap sizing flags against the tuning doc, not the defaults. Do not ship with the old collector enabled. Record the build token below.

pipeline stamp: htk6_7941f2

// Client setup for the Splitgrove assignment service.
// Plugin authors: assignments are resolved server-side; do not cache
// variant results locally for longer than the session. The client
// retries twice on timeout, then falls back to the control arm.
// Initialize against the sandbox endpoint first and verify your
// experiment slug resolves. Authenticate the client with the key below.

service key, hawif-kadup: vxb7-VMYtoba